William Koch is a senior real-time controls engineer with 12 years of experience building flight control and autonomy systems, currently applying his expertise at Commonwealth Fusion Systems. He has led autonomous navigation and advanced flight-controls teams at Merlin, designing full-stack solutions from system identification and controller design to flight test execution and tuning, with 50+ sorties as a test director. His background bridges academic research and industry: a PhD-trained researcher who created Neuroflight and GymFC—the first open-source neural-network flight control firmware and training environment—and published in top venues on cyber-physical security. Practical, safety-critical software, deep control theory, and security-aware engineering converge in his work, and he’s known for shipping productionized control systems that emerged from open research prototypes.
